 Leisure Services  return to top
Senior Services
learn more
   The Department of Senior Services currently operates four direct service programs: the Senior Transportation Program, the Adult Day Services Program, the Senior Nutrition Program and the Senior Services Center. Advocacy and technical assistance are also major functional areas within this department.

 Planning and Zoning  return to top
Zoning and Building Inspection
learn more
   The Zoning and Building Inspection Office is charged with enforcement of the Zoning Ordinance, the Rhode Island State Building Code, the Minimum Housing Code and the Tourist Accommodation Ordinance. Assistance is also rendered to other Town departments within the Office's field of expertise.

 Public Safety  return to top
Police
learn more
   The Mission Philosophy of the South Kingstown Police Department is a component of the Department Rules and Regulations, which were adopted and approved in accordance with the Town Charter by the Town Council in August 1987.
Fire Department
learn more
   Services are provided by two independently operated volunteer districts. The Union Fire District, and the Kingston Fire District.
Emergency Medical Services
learn more
   The purpose of the Division is to provide pre-hospital emergency medical treatment and transportation of the critically sick or injured.
Animal Shelter
learn more
   Founded in 1980, the South Kingstown Animal Shelter accepts neglected, abandoned and/or stray dogs and cats.
Animal Control
learn more
   To enforce the Town's leash law, respond to complaints concerning stray animals, enforce State Laws concerning animals and provide humane education for animal owners.
 
 Public Services  return to top
Public Service
learn more
   The Department of Public Services is responsible for the administration, planning and design of all public works and utility enterprise fund programs and projects. It is comprised of the following divisions: Engineering, Streets and Highway, Wastewater, Water, Solid Waste and Onsite Wastewater Management.
Communications Department
learn more
   The Communications Department is charged with enforcement of the Rhode Island Fire Prevention Code, as it pertains to the installation and maintenance of commercial fire alarm systems for all new and existing buildings in South Kingstown.
